Data Formats
At a high level, data formats are the specific ways in which data is organized and stored. Think of them as different languages that computers use to "read" and "write" information. Just like humans use different languages and alphabets, computers rely on various formats to make sense of the vast amounts of data they process. Understanding these formats is crucial for anyone working with data, as the choice of format can significantly impact how efficiently data is stored, accessed, and used.
